Tag: frog

  • Spider and the Frog

    Spider and the Frog

    In the heart of Africa, where the soil thrums with ancient stories and the trees whisper secrets of old, there lies a tale of unity and cooperation. This is not just any story; it’s a folktale that has been passed down through generations, embodying the essence of community and the power of working together. It’s…